Indonesia and Tajikistan Agree to Strengthen Bilateral Cooperation

12 hours ago 9

TEMPO.CO, JakartaIndonesia’s Minister of Foreign Affairs, Sugiono, met with the Non-Resident Ambassador of Tajikistan, Ardasher Qodiri, at the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MOFA) office in Jakarta on Tuesday, March 4. The discussion reaffirmed both countries’ commitment to strengthening bilateral ties, particularly in economic cooperation.

According to an official statement from MOFA, Sugiono welcomed the increasing high-level exchanges between Indonesia and Tajikistan, including the visit of Tajikistan’s Prime Minister to the 10th World Water Forum in Bali last year.

Tajikistan is currently the largest investor from Central Asia in Indonesia, with total investments reaching US$5 million (Rp81.5 billion) over the past five years. Sugiono expressed hope that Tajikistan would continue expanding its investments, particularly in the downstream mineral industry. This initiative aligns with President Prabowo Subianto’s Asta Cita vision, which focuses on industrialization to boost domestic value-added production.

Looking ahead, both countries aim to finalize and sign several agreements to further enhance cooperation in politics and trade.

Indonesia and Tajikistan have maintained diplomatic relations for 30 years. Over time, collaboration has grown across various sectors, including the economy, politics, social affairs, education, culture, and tourism.

Indonesia’s Ambassador to Kazakhstan and Tajikistan, M. Fadjroel Rachman, emphasized this progress, stating, “Diplomatic relations between Indonesia, Kazakhstan, and Tajikistan continue to strengthen across multiple fields.” His remarks were made during a New Year’s celebration at Wisma Indonesia Kazakhstan on December 31, 2024, as quoted in an official release from the Indonesian Embassy in Astana.
